The office building was developed with three standard plans of different dimensions, featuring a staggering that took place from three variables: elevator zoning, optimization of fire escapes, and most importantly, the integration of the building in the urban context.

The basic concept of the adopted solution was to place great emphasis on the symbolic function of the Court. For this, the building was isolated from the land, raising it ten meters above ground level.
